Rajasthan HC Directs to Conduct Training of Principal Magistrates in JJ Boards - (15 Jul 2021)

CIVIL

Rajasthan High Court has directed Child Rights Department of the State Government to ensure that a training programme is conducted for Principal Magistrates posted in Juvenile Justice Boards in order to sensitize them with the mandate of Juvenile Justice Act, 2015.
